Define Factorial method to Calculate Nitrogen Requirements?
The nitrogen requirements have been calculated by a factorial method suggested by different expert groups, described as follows:
R=U+F+S+G
Where R = N requirements,
U = loss of endogenous N in urine,
F = loss of endogenous N in faeces,
S = loss of N through skin, i.e., sweat and integumental losses, and
G = N required for growth.
